We report the first genome-wide mapping of fragility hotspots after siRNA-mediated knockdown of the DEAD-box helicase DDX41 in HCT116 cells using sBLISS. DDX41 defficient cells display elevated levels of genomic instability. sBLISS analysis revealed that hotspots for genomic instability in the absence of DDX41 are located around the transcription start site of transcribed genes. Genome-wide mapping of DNA double-strand breaks by sBLISS upon siRNA-mediated knockdown of DDX41 was performed in human adenocarcinoma HCT116 cells. Non-targeting siRNA was used as a control. The experiment was carried out in biological replicates.
